Residential Landscape Drainage in Birmingham, AL
Residential landscape drainage services focus on managing excess water on a property to prevent flooding, erosion, and water damage. These services typically include installing drainage systems such as French drains, surface drains, and sump pumps to redirect water away from foundations, walkways, and landscaped areas. Projects can range from addressing specific problem spots caused by poor grading or heavy rainfall to comprehensive drainage solutions for entire yards. Homeowners often seek these services to protect their property’s structural integrity, maintain a safe outdoor environment, and improve the overall landscape health.
Before requesting landscape drainage services, property owners should consider the existing drainage issues and the areas most affected during heavy rain or storms. Understanding the property’s slope, soil type, and current water flow patterns can help determine the most effective solutions. It’s also helpful to identify specific concerns such as basement flooding, pooling water, or erosion on slopes. Clear information about these issues can assist in designing a drainage system tailored to the property’s needs, ensuring effective water management and long-term landscape stability.

Common Residential Landscape Drainage Jobs
French Drain Installation - directs excess water away from foundations to prevent pooling and flooding.
Surface Drainage Solutions - improves yard runoff to reduce erosion and standing water.
Downspout Drainage Systems - channels roof runoff safely away from the property to protect landscaping and structures.
Drainage System Repairs - addresses clogs, leaks, or damage to maintain effective water flow.
Grading and Sloping - adjusts yard contours to promote proper water runoff and prevent water accumulation.
Erosion Control Services - stabilizes slopes and garden beds to prevent soil loss caused by excess water.
Residential Landscape Drainage Questions
What is residential landscape drainage? It involves designing and installing systems to manage excess water runoff and prevent water pooling around a property.
Why is proper drainage important for a yard? Effective drainage helps protect the foundation, prevents soil erosion, and keeps outdoor areas usable during heavy rains.
What types of drainage solutions are available? Common options include French drains, surface drains, and sump pump systems tailored to specific yard conditions.
How can drainage issues be identified? Signs include standing water after rain, soggy patches, or water pooling near the foundation or walkways.
